In medical terms, C4 most commonly refers to Complement component 4, a crucial protein that plays a significant role in the body's immune defense system, specifically as part of the complement system.
Understanding Complement Component 4 (C4)
C4, or Complement component 4, is a specialized protein found both on the surface of certain cells and circulating within the blood plasma. It is one of nearly 60 proteins that collectively form the complement system, a sophisticated network that collaborates closely with your immune system to defend the body against pathogens and help clear damaged cells.
Key Characteristics of C4:
- Immune Defense: C4 is instrumental in initiating various complement pathways, contributing to the body's ability to identify and eliminate harmful invaders like bacteria and viruses.
- Protein Structure: Like other complement proteins, C4 exists in different forms and is activated in a cascade-like manner, meaning one protein activates the next in a sequence.
- Location: You'll find C4 on cell surfaces, where it can mediate cell interactions, and in the blood plasma, where it can react to circulating threats.
Role of the Complement System
The complement system, of which C4 is an integral part, performs several vital functions for maintaining health:
- Pathogen Lysis: It can directly destroy foreign cells by forming a membrane attack complex (MAC) that creates holes in their membranes.
- Opsonization: It marks pathogens for destruction by phagocytic cells (like macrophages), making them easier for the immune system to "eat."
- Inflammation: It recruits immune cells to sites of infection or injury, promoting an inflammatory response to clear threats and aid healing.
- Immune Complex Clearance: It helps remove immune complexes (antibodies bound to antigens) from the circulation, preventing them from depositing in tissues and causing damage.
Clinical Significance of C4 Levels
Measuring C4 levels in blood tests can provide important insights into a patient's immune status and help diagnose certain conditions.
When C4 Levels are Measured:
- Autoimmune Diseases: Levels may be depressed in conditions like Systemic Lupus Erythematosus (SLE) or certain forms of glomerulonephritis, indicating active disease where complement components are being consumed.
- Infections: C4 levels can be elevated during acute infections as the complement system is highly active in fighting off pathogens.
- Hereditary Angioedema (HAE): While primarily associated with C1 inhibitor deficiency, C4 levels are often low in HAE patients, especially during attacks, making it a useful diagnostic marker.
- Complement Deficiencies: Rarely, individuals can have genetic deficiencies in C4, leading to increased susceptibility to infections or autoimmune conditions.
Interpreting C4 Test Results:
C4 Level | Potential Implication | Associated Conditions (Examples) |
---|---|---|
Low C4 | Active consumption of complement, genetic deficiency, or impaired production | Systemic Lupus Erythematosus (SLE), Hereditary Angioedema (HAE), Sepsis |
Normal C4 | Usually indicates healthy complement function, or certain inactive diseases | (May vary depending on specific clinical context) |
High C4 | Acute inflammation, infection, or some cancers | Bacterial infections, Rheumatoid Arthritis (sometimes), certain malignancies |
Note: C4 levels are typically interpreted alongside other complement components (like C3) and a full clinical picture.
Other Medical Interpretations of "C4"
While Complement Component 4 is the primary medical meaning, especially in immunology, "C4" can also refer to other entities in different medical contexts:
- Cervical Vertebra 4: In anatomy and spinal medicine, "C4" denotes the fourth cervical vertebra in the neck, which is part of the bony structure protecting the spinal cord. Injuries or conditions affecting C4 can impact nerve function, particularly diaphragm movement for breathing.
- Carbon-4: In biochemistry, it might refer to the fourth carbon atom in a specific molecule, or in the context of C4 photosynthesis in plants, though this is less common in direct human medicine.
However, when discussing "C4 in medical terms" without further context, the Complement component 4 is the most widely understood and clinically relevant interpretation in the field of immunology and infectious diseases.
